On the night of November 29, Russian troops attacked the territory of Ukraine with Shahed-type drones and Kh-59 missiles, the Air Force of the Ukrainian Armed Forces announced.

According to Ukrainian forces, a total of 21 strike drones and three missiles were used in the attack. Fighters, anti-aircraft missile units and mobile fire groups participated in repelling the attack.

According to the report, all launched Russian drones were destroyed within the Odesa, Mykolaiv, Dnipropetrovsk, Kyiv, Kherson, Zaporozhye and Khmelnytskyi regions. Two missiles were destroyed within the limits of the Nikolaev region, another one, according to the Armed Forces of Ukraine, “did not reach the desired target.”

Over the past day, four people were injured as a result of shelling in the Kherson region, the head of the regional military administration, Alexander Prokudin, reported on Wednesday morning.

In the Kharkiv region, the settlements of the Kharkiv, Chuguev and Kupyan districts came under shelling in the last day: there are no casualties, but there is destruction.

Seven local residents were wounded in the Donetsk region on November 28, Igor Moroz, acting head of the regional military administration, reported.

The Russian side did not comment on reports of shelling.
